Output 42f55524cda63dab746501aa2c69108cba15b43fd339a83839bde0eefafedd37:0

value
1706822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ba396a6dae184a5b778397c2ae9f211daa52376 OP_EQUAL
address
3MiMst6Lnd1JqXbYYfXE9yay1jwxuTt2kb
transaction
42f55524cda63dab746501aa2c69108cba15b43fd339a83839bde0eefafedd37
spent
true